In ancient Egypt, it was believed that when you die you are forced to weigh your heart against a feather to determine your moral worth, and the only way to get to the Field of Reeds (the ancient Egyptians' version of heaven) was to possess a heart that was lighter than the feather on the golden scales of Osiris. The amount of air resistance an object experiences depends on its speed, its cross-sectional area, its shape and the density of the air.
